How needs-based assessments could advance equity in the global stocktake and beyond

Sonja Klinsky ()
Additional contact information
Sonja Klinsky: Arizona State University

Nature Climate Change, 2023, vol. 13, issue 10, 1007-1009

Abstract: The global stocktake (GST) could both enable and hamper the inclusion of equity. This Comment outlines why equity is central to the GST and the challenges faced in addressing it, as well as the utility of needs-based assessments for advancing equity within the GST and the climate action generally.
